Creole Sauce (Salsa Criolla)

This particular Creole sauce recipe is a zesty accompaniment to seafood and fish dishes.

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Cook Time: 00 minutes

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up tomato puree
  • 1/4 cup fresh lime juice
  • 1 cup onions (finely chopped)
  • 1 tablespoon chili pepper (finely chopped)
  • salt and black pepper to taste
  • 3 pimiento stuffed olives (cut into slices)

Preparation:

1. In a bowl, thoroughly blend together the tomato puree, lime juice, onions, celery, chili pepper, salt, and black pepper.

2. Stir in the olive slices.

3. Serve at once or refrigerate up to 6 days.
